I noticed on one of the flaps of the book's paper dust jacket two websites one for the book and to other to the author. One offers a blog, I was thinking of informing them that there a two Jurisdictions of Scottish Rite here in the states. I see the Dan Brown lives in the New England Area not far from the Northern Masonic Jurisdiction of Scottish Rite in Lexington, MA. Thought at least he should know. True it's not in Washington, DC nor as eye popping as the Southern Jurisdiction. I never took notice of the House of the Temple till a few years ago. Yes i have been to Scottish Rite outside of my Jurisdiction. As for headquarters I never gave it a thought.

I will have to look at that part again. Could "Alex Toil" be an anagram? Is the watch one with Masonic Emblems on the dial instead of the usual numbers or marks? I have one like that at home.


The letters of Alex Toil can be rearranged to form Leo Taxil as in the Leo Taxil Hoax. :P
